Advertisement
Guest User

Untitled

a guest
Aug 18th, 2019
215
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 5.41 KB | None | 0 0
  1. // GENERATED BY UNITY. REMOVE THIS COMMENT TO PREVENT OVERWRITING WHEN EXPORTING AGAIN
  2. buildscript {
  3. repositories {
  4. google()
  5. jcenter()
  6. }
  7.  
  8. dependencies {
  9. classpath 'com.android.tools.build:gradle:3.2.0'
  10. }
  11. }
  12.  
  13. allprojects {
  14. repositories {
  15. google()
  16. jcenter()
  17. flatDir {
  18. dirs 'libs'
  19. }
  20. }
  21. }
  22.  
  23. // Android Resolver Repos Start
  24. ([rootProject] + (rootProject.subprojects as List)).each { project ->
  25. project.repositories {
  26. def unityProjectPath = "file:///" + file(rootProject.projectDir.path + "/../../").absolutePath
  27. maven {
  28. url "https://maven.google.com"
  29. }
  30. maven {
  31. url (unityProjectPath + "/Assets/Firebase/m2repository") // Assets/Firebase/Editor/AnalyticsDependencies.xml:20, Assets/Firebase/Editor/AppDependencies.xml:20, Assets/Firebase/Editor/CrashlyticsDependencies.xml:20, Assets/Firebase/Editor/MessagingDependencies.xml:22, Assets/Firebase/Editor/RemoteConfigDependencies.xml:22
  32. }
  33. maven {
  34. url "https://maven.google.com" //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:10,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:19,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:27,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:35,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:40
  35. }
  36. mavenLocal()
  37. jcenter()
  38. mavenCentral()
  39. }
  40. }
  41. // Android Resolver Repos End
  42. apply plugin: 'com.android.application'
  43.  
  44. dependencies {
  45. implementation fileTree(dir: 'libs', include: ['*.jar'])
  46. implementation 'com.android.support:multidex:1.0.3'
  47. // Android Resolver Dependencies Start
  48. implementation 'com.android.support:recyclerview-v7:26.1.0' //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:35
  49. implementation 'com.android.support:support-v4:26.1.0' //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:27
  50. implementation 'com.crashlytics.sdk.android:crashlytics:2.9.9' // Assets/Firebase/Editor/CrashlyticsDependencies.xml:15
  51. implementation 'com.google.android.exoplayer:exoplayer:2.8.4' //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:40
  52. implementation 'com.google.android.gms:play-services-ads:15.0.1' //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:10
  53. implementation 'com.google.android.gms:play-services-location:15.0.1' // Assets/GoogleMobileAds/Editor/GoogleMobileAdsDependencies.xml:19
  54. implementation 'com.google.auto.value:auto-value-annotations:1.6.3' // Assets/Firebase/Editor/AppDependencies.xml:22
  55. implementation 'com.google.firebase:firebase-analytics:16.5.0' // Assets/Firebase/Editor/RemoteConfigDependencies.xml:15
  56. implementation 'com.google.firebase:firebase-analytics-unity:6.1.1' // Assets/Firebase/Editor/AnalyticsDependencies.xml:20
  57. implementation 'com.google.firebase:firebase-app-unity:6.1.1' // Assets/Firebase/Editor/AppDependencies.xml:20
  58. implementation 'com.google.firebase:firebase-common:17.1.0' // Assets/Firebase/Editor/AppDependencies.xml:13
  59. implementation 'com.google.firebase:firebase-config:17.0.0' // Assets/Firebase/Editor/RemoteConfigDependencies.xml:13
  60. implementation 'com.google.firebase:firebase-config-unity:6.1.1' // Assets/Firebase/Editor/RemoteConfigDependencies.xml:22
  61. implementation 'com.google.firebase:firebase-crashlytics-unity:6.1.1' // Assets/Firebase/Editor/CrashlyticsDependencies.xml:20
  62. implementation 'com.google.firebase:firebase-iid:[18.0.0]' // Assets/Firebase/Editor/RemoteConfigDependencies.xml:17
  63. implementation 'com.google.firebase:firebase-messaging:18.0.0' // Assets/Firebase/Editor/MessagingDependencies.xml:17
  64. implementation 'com.google.firebase:firebase-messaging-unity:6.1.1' // Assets/Firebase/Editor/MessagingDependencies.xml:22
  65. // Android Resolver Dependencies End
  66. **DEPS**}
  67.  
  68. // Android Resolver Exclusions Start
  69. android {
  70. packagingOptions {
  71. // exclude ('/lib/arm64-v8a/*' + '*')
  72. // exclude ('/lib/armeabi/*' + '*')
  73. // exclude ('/lib/mips/*' + '*')
  74. // exclude ('/lib/mips64/*' + '*')
  75. // exclude ('/lib/x86/*' + '*')
  76. // exclude ('/lib/x86_64/*' + '*')
  77. }
  78. }
  79. // Android Resolver Exclusions End
  80. android {
  81. compileSdkVersion **APIVERSION**
  82. buildToolsVersion '**BUILDTOOLS**'
  83.  
  84. defaultConfig {
  85. minSdkVersion **MINSDKVERSION**
  86. targetSdkVersion **TARGETSDKVERSION**
  87. multiDexEnabled true
  88. applicationId '**APPLICATIONID**'
  89. ndk {
  90. abiFilters **ABIFILTERS**
  91. }
  92.  
  93. versionCode 1052
  94. }
  95.  
  96. lintOptions {
  97. abortOnError false
  98. }
  99.  
  100. aaptOptions {
  101. noCompress '.unity3d', '.ress', '.resource', '.obb'**STREAMING_ASSETS**
  102. }
  103.  
  104. **SIGN**
  105. buildTypes {
  106. debug {
  107. minifyEnabled **MINIFY_DEBUG**
  108. useProguard **PROGUARD_DEBUG**
  109. pro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-unity.txt'**USER_PROGUARD**
  110. jniDebuggable true
  111. }
  112. release {
  113. minifyEnabled **MINIFY_RELEASE**
  114. useProguard **PROGUARD_RELEASE**
  115. pro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-unity.txt'**USER_PROGUARD**
  116. **SIGNCONFIG**
  117. }
  118. }
  119.  
  120.  
  121. **PACKAGING_OPTIONS**
  122. bundle {
  123. language {
  124. enableSplit = false
  125. }
  126. density {
  127. enableSplit = false
  128. }
  129. abi {
  130. enableSplit = true
  131. }
  132. }
  133. }
  134.  
  135.  
  136. **SOURCE_BUILD_SETUP**
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ement